Bactericidal; inhibits cell wall synthesis by binding to penicillin-binding proteins (PBPs), disrupting peptidoglycan cross-linking.
Ceftin (cefuroxime axetil) is a second-generation cephalosporin antibiotic that inhibits bacterial cell wall synthesis by binding to penicillin-binding proteins (PBPs), specifically transpeptidases, thereby disrupting peptidoglycan cross-linking. This leads to cell lysis and death primarily during active cell division.
